At L'Oréal, your potential is what truly matters. Join our Packaging teams at the UXDesign Lab as an Intern CMF Designer (Colors, Materials & Finishes Designer).

Our team of designers, experts in packaging, product design, experience design and CMF, are dedicated and passionate about creating the best sustainable and desirable packaging of the future. As a CMF Design intern, your mission is to create innovative and impactful color, material, and finish designs that align with the brand vision. Incorporate a strong understanding of sensoriality into the CMF design process to create products that not only look good, but also feel good to the customer. Consider texture, grip, and overall sensory experience, while inventing codes of sustainability and desirability with a holistic approach that weighs aesthetic appeal and environmental impact.

About L’Oréal

As the world's leading beauty group, we operate in 150 countries with 37 international brands across four divisions: Consumer Products, Professional Products, Dermatological Beauty, and Luxe. We create beauty that acts, inspires, and unites, combining technology, science, and natural inspiration to offer inclusive and future-oriented beauty.
